PJT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

242 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PJT Partners (PJT)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$1.21B — up 24% from $979M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 51 funds opened new PJT positions and 19 closed out — a net gain of 32 holders — while 60 added to existing stakes and 74 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$33.4M. The largest seller was MHR Fund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$53.4M sold.
